Paroli Strategy
Paroli Strategy

Paroli is one of the first roulette strategies studied by fans of this type of gambling entertainment. This betting system is as simple as possible and boils down to doubling the amount at stake twice after each win. With a long enough streak of luck, a very big score can be snapped, and if luck turns its back, the loss is only one initial bet. The Paroli strategy is discussed in more detail in the review.

Another Way Strategy
Another Way Strategy

Playing roulette according to the Another Way betting strategy, you will bet on straights, splits, and streets, selecting numbers on the basis of the outcomes of several previous spins. The system does not include an increase in bets after a win or loss, so it cannot be treated as a betting progression. You will need to memorize seven rules and attentively monitor their use. Details of this system are explained in our review.

Anti-Martingale Strategy
Anti-Martingale Strategy

Everyone is familiar with the Martingale system intended for roulette. It offers doubling the bet after each loss. This article deals with the strategy that is its antithesis. The anti-Martingale strategy implies that you will double the bet in case of your victory and reduce the wagered sum by half after a loss. Intricacies of this method, with all its advantages and disadvantages, are discussed in the review published on Casinoz.
